en:programming_tasks
Differences
This shows you the differences between two versions of the page.
| Both sides previous revisionPrevious revisionNext revision | Previous revision | ||
| en:programming_tasks [2014/07/09 22:51] – [The hardware implementation] kaklik | en:programming_tasks [Unknown date] (current) – external edit (Unknown date) 127.0.0.1 | ||
|---|---|---|---|
| Line 57: | Line 57: | ||
| == Network interface == | == Network interface == | ||
| - | Station supervisor software should generate data file outputs | + | We will not have direct IP connectivity from Internet to stations. |
| Moreover web access is intended as file based. File based means that | Moreover web access is intended as file based. File based means that | ||
| - | station-supervisor uploads an diagnostic file to webserver. Webserver | + | station-supervisor uploads an diagnostic file to the central web server. Web server |
| - | takes this file (probably | + | on web server. |
| - | page with stations status information. User interface in this case is | + | |
| - | limited only to modification of an station-supervisor | + | |
| - | on webserver. Config file may contain an parameter for station reboot | + | |
| - | request. After station-supervisor notice change or update in the | + | |
| - | webserver stored configfile, station-supervisor reboots the station and | + | |
| - | update its parameters according to actual config file. | + | |
| - | This approach is needed, because we usually have not direct IP | + | For example configuration file may contain an parameter for station reboot |
| - | connectivity from Internet | + | request. After station-supervisor will notice a change or update in the |
| + | web server stored configuration file, station-supervisor reboots the station and | ||
| + | update its parameters according | ||
| - | Data-upload is another daemon, which manages storage space on measuring node. | + | === Node software === |
| + | Node hardware will run a data-processing utility ([[en: | ||
| + | |||
| + | Station-supervisor does not have a screen output. Screen output may be served by client program ssmon (Station Supervisor Monitor) which generates interactive status screen after connection to Station Supervisor server. | ||
| Line 94: | Line 93: | ||
| ==== Software implementation | ==== Software implementation | ||
| - | The network management would be advantageous to use the system to control robots [[http:// | + | The network management would be advantageous to use the system to control robots [[http:// |
| === Data Processing | === Data Processing | ||
| Line 214: | Line 213: | ||
| The result of this calculation could be used for observation planning. | The result of this calculation could be used for observation planning. | ||
| - | ===== Implementation | + | ==== References ==== |
| + | |||
| + | * [[https:// | ||
| + | * [[http:// | ||
| + | ===== Implementation | ||
| ==== Investigators ==== | ==== Investigators ==== | ||
| Line 220: | Line 223: | ||
| The project is implemented by a team of several students CTU, TU and members of Robozor robotics club: | The project is implemented by a team of several students CTU, TU and members of Robozor robotics club: | ||
| - | * [[https:// | ||
| * Martin Povišer - Signal digitalization and storage decentralization | * Martin Povišer - Signal digitalization and storage decentralization | ||
| * [[https:// | * [[https:// | ||
en/programming_tasks.1404946270.txt.gz · Last modified: 2014/07/09 22:51 (external edit)
